简介:今天,首席CTO Note将与您分享有关Vuedjango的好内容。如果您可以解决您现在面临的问题,请不要忘记注意此网站。让我们现在开始!
本文目录清单:
1. Python的三个网络框架中的更好?Python 3中的好Web框架是什么,Python语言Django框架是书面背景,前端是Vue React Layui Angular?和龙卷风。如果这三个网络框架更好,建议Django提前帮助我们进行了很多工作。您可以先从Django学习,然后学习烧瓶和龙卷风。让我们仔细研究Python的三个网络框架的细节。
1. Django
Django是一个具有开源代码的Web应用程序框架,由Python编写。MTV框架模式,即Model M,Template T和View V.T最初开发的是管理Lawrence Publisting Group拥有的一些网站。
2.烧瓶
烧瓶是用Python编写的轻量级Web应用程序框架。ITSWSGI Toolbox使用Werkzeug,模板引擎使用Jinja2
EssenceFlask由BSD授权。
烧瓶也称为“微框架”,因为它使用了简单的内核并使用扩展
添加其他函数。flask没有默认数据库和窗口验证工具。
烧瓶非常轻,支出的成本非常小,可以开发一个简单的网站。适合初学者学习。烧瓶框架协会后,您可以考虑学习插件的使用。例如,使用wtform +
Flask-Wtform验证表单数据并使用Sqlalchemy + Blask-Sqlalchemy来控制您的数据库。
3.龙卷风
龙卷风是Web Server Software.Tornado和当前主流Web服务器框架的开源版本(包括大多数Python
框架)有明显的差异:它是一台非烧烤服务器,速度非常快。
如果它适合其非块方法和使用Epoll的使用,龙卷风可以每秒处理数千个连接,因此龙卷风是真正的-Time Web服务
理想的框架。
关于Python的三个网络框架的简要介绍,我将在这里为所有人分享。当然,学习是无尽的。学习人生的技能利益。让我们赶紧学习。
1. Django
Python中最全能的Web开发框架,完整的功能,维护和开发速度首先是级别,许多人对Django框架做出了缓慢的响应,它主要是Djangoomor和数据库之间的相互作用较慢,因此是否使用Django Frameworkit,需要取决于项目对数据库交互和各种优化的要求。对于Django的同步特征,芹菜可以解决小吞吐量的问题,这不是致命的问题。
2.龙卷风
异步和强大的性能,但是与Django框架相比,它相对原始,许多事情需要由自己处理。随着项目逐渐扩展,框架可以提供的功能将变得越来越小。更多的事情需要团队参加团队。要自己实现这一目标,并且大型项目通常需要绩效保证,目前这是最好的选择。
3.烧瓶
可以说微型框架是Python代码的最佳项目之一。它的灵活性也是一把双刃剑。它可以使用烧瓶框架,也就是说,它可以制成pinterest。但是它也可以将其制成大型烧瓶,此外,它可以自由选择自己的数据库交互式组件,并在添加异步功能(例如Clery+)之后雷迪斯(Redis),烧瓶的性能比龙卷风可比。也许烧瓶的灵活性可能是可能需要更多的团队。
4.扭曲
前面提到的三个网络框架是在应用程序层HTTP周围进行的,而扭曲是不同的。这是一个由Python语言驱动的网络框架。对于应用服务器性能的应用是一个很好的选择。
它支持许多协议,包括传输层的UDP,TCP,TLS和应用层的HTTP,FTP。对于这些协议,Twisted提供了客户和服务器开发工具。
这是一个高性能的编程框架。在不同的操作系统上,扭曲使用不同的基础技术来实现高性能的交流。在开发方法方面,使用异步编程模型的扭曲指南程序员。它提供了丰富的延期,螺纹核能的特性,以支持异步编程。
如果该项目需要效率,建议使用两个准备好的制造。
提供2种准备好
Drupal
果园
结论:以上是首席CTO注释为每个人编写的Vuedjango相关内容的良好内容。希望它对您有所帮助!如果您解决了问题,请与更多关心此问题的朋友分享?